Abstract

In order to evaluate the weapon strike effect in the joint of ship formation, this paper discusses the influence of platform positioning and orientation error on weapon strike effect. Based on the mathematical model, the damage expectation of platform positioning and orientation error, the long-range strike accuracy of shipboard missile and the target indicating accuracy of cross-platform are analyzed quantitatively. The model includes weapon strike likelihood, the navigation positioning error model and error transfer model of ship platform. The simulation was be perform in MATLAB environment. The larger the positioning and orientation error is, the more cross platform target sign error will increase. And the acquisition probability and weapon strike effect of missile long-range attack will reduce.
